Perhaps Villanova head coach Kevin Willard regrets saying this one out loud.
During a sideline interview midway through Villanova’s 86-76 loss against Utah State in the first round of March Madness on Friday, Willard joked that he was going to fire his coaching staff.
“I’m gonna fire my staff,” Willard wildly quipped on the TNT broadcast after being asked what his team was going to do to stop the Aggies’ dominance in the paint. “Yeah, I am because we’ve given up eight points on out-of-bounds defense. The only thing I’m gonna do is fire them and get a new staff.”

APVillanova was down 22-16 with 11:00 left in the first half when the interview was conducted, which likely contributed to Willard’s frustration.
Willard, a Huntington native, is in his first season at the helm of the Wildcats, leading them to a 24-9 record, their best since the 2021-22 season, which was the last time Villanova reached the NCAA Tournament under longtime head coach Jay Wright.
Ahead of this year’s March Madness, Willard issued a subtle warning to his players about the transfer portal.
“For the most part, really enjoy it,” Willard told reporters Thursday. “You’re one of 68 teams to make it to the best tournament, arguably, in all of sports. Really enjoy it because next year, you’re not promised it.

The Wildcats wound up getting outscored by 12 points in the second half, which paved the way for the Aggies to pull off the win.
Junior guard Mason Falslev led the way for Utah State, scoring 22 points and grabbing six rebounds while shooting 9-of-16 from the field.
Utah State is now set to face off against Arizona, which defeated Long Island in a 92-58 blowout win on Friday afternoon.
